Floristeria - 10 things to know with detail
- 1. Floristeria is the Spanish word for a florist shop, where customers can purchase a variety of fresh flowers, arrangements, and plants.
- 2. Floristerias are typically staffed by trained florists who can provide advice on choosing the right flowers for different occasions and help create custom arrangements.
- 3. Floristerias often offer a wide selection of flowers, including roses, lilies, tulips, orchids, and more, as well as seasonal arrangements for holidays like Valentine's Day and Mother's Day.
- 4. In addition to fresh flowers, floristerias may also sell plants, vases, and other accessories to complement floral arrangements.
- 5. Many floristerias offer delivery services, allowing customers to send flowers to loved ones for special occasions or just to brighten their day.
- 6. Some floristerias specialize in creating wedding or event floral arrangements, working closely with clients to design beautiful centerpieces, bouquets, and decorations.
- 7. Floristerias may also offer services for corporate clients, providing floral arrangements for office spaces, events, and client gifts.
- 8. Customers can often place orders for flowers online or over the phone, making it convenient to send flowers for birthdays, anniversaries, or other occasions.
- 9. Floristerias may also provide flower arrangement classes or workshops for those interested in learning how to create their own beautiful bouquets and centerpieces.
